The developers pledge to invest massively in public transport, even offering to fund the long-awaited East-West Rail Link (link below.)

"A new station will be built at Weston Otmoor.
"Up to five trains per hour in each direction (to Oxford in six minutes) will be provided.
"A chord line to Bicester will mean a one-hour journey time to London."
The eco-town would also have a continuously running tram system, with a free transport service into Oxford.
Keith Mitchell, the leader of Oxfordshire County Council, said because of the promise of infrastructure investment, the council would not be opposing the scheme out of hand. But he said he remained sceptical about whether it would "stack up financially"
A bridge over the A34, based on the world-famous Ponte Vecchio in Florence, is set to be the centrepiece of the eco-town.
